Output 29096b73f3f9030f52a933af19af24a331db9ff7cdfbdd469409d730205def3c:4

value
66325870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76dae542f06c2b469a82b480f23f0bd406cae6fa OP_EQUAL
address
MJjcCCJxbsH8jPHouns1meQchWwDwvEZGn
transaction
29096b73f3f9030f52a933af19af24a331db9ff7cdfbdd469409d730205def3c
spent
true